Money Talks: Odds of Home Dialysis Dropped with Medicare Bundled Payments
People with traditional Medicare saw a 12% drop in the odds of receiving home dialysis after CMS changed to the bundle, vs. those in Medicare Advantage plans, who were not affected, finds a new study. And, those in areas with larger clinics—where nephrologists can swing by and see (and bill for) many patients in a short time—had a 16% drop vs. those in areas with smaller clinics. Follow the money…
